About PE Ratio & Methodology

The price-to-earnings (P/E) ratio for AA Mission Acquisition Corp. (AAM) measures how much investors pay for each dollar of the company's trailing earnings. AAM's current PE ratio of 606.65x is calculated by dividing its stock price of $10.66 by its TTM earnings per share of $0.02.

PE Ratio = Stock Price ÷ EPS (TTM)
= $10.66 ÷ $0.02 = 606.65x
TTMTrailing Twelve Months — sum of the most recent 4 quarterly EPS figures
Forward PEStock price ÷ analyst consensus EPS estimate for the next fiscal year
PEGPE ÷ earnings growth rate — values below 1.0 suggest growth may justify the premium
